hello, i'm new here.
i've recently migrated to W7 ultimate from XP SP2 and a there are quite a few things that i find hard getting used to.
one of those is spacing between the icons in system tray - it's too big. is there any way to "squeeze" them? i don't want to hide them, i like to have them all shown (there is about ten icons), but they take too much space on taskbar.

You may increase the number of icons that can be accommodated in the taskbar by increasing the height of the taskbar. Simply drag the taskbar upside to increase the width. I don’t think there is a way to reduce the space between taskbar icons.
